Output efcfa8aac23585f44e022826073770cd4055a6fc66a1ca7691ad39d0620a3ec9:77

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 feaebd86629221ad2b5a5c769f39b8a77f1baf66e72f4b3fa26421b0da6be590
address
bc1pl6htmpnzjgs66266t3mf7wdc5al3htmxuuh5k0azvssmpkntukgqkh74s8
transaction
efcfa8aac23585f44e022826073770cd4055a6fc66a1ca7691ad39d0620a3ec9
spent
true